![]() ![]() Namibia People - 2002 https://greekorthodoxchurch.org/wfb2002/namibia/namibia_people.html SOURCE: 2002 CIA WORLD FACTBOOK Population
1,820,916
Age structure
Population growth rate 1.19% (2002 est.) Birth rate 34.17 births/1,000 population (2002 est.) Death rate 22.28 deaths/1,000 population (2002 est.) Net migration rate 0 migrant(s)/1,000 population (2002 est.) Sex ratio
Infant mortality rate 72.43 deaths/1,000 live births (2002 est.) Life expectancy at birth
Total fertility rate 4.77 children born/woman (2002 est.) HIV/AIDS - adult prevalence rate 19.54% (1999 est.) HIV/AIDS - people living with HIV/AIDS 160,000 (1999 est.) HIV/AIDS - deaths 18,000 (1999 est.) Nationality
Ethnic groups
black 87.5%, white 6%, mixed 6.5%
Religions Christian 80% to 90% (Lutheran 50% at least), indigenous beliefs 10% to 20% Languages English 7% (official), Afrikaans common language of most of the population and about 60% of the white population, German 32%, indigenous languages: Oshivambo, Herero, Nama Literacy
